    American Metals yard on Broadway in Mesa, AZ. They buy s**** metal of all kinds and sell new steel as well. They have s**** stuff at the door to the new steel sales office where the pieces are normally $0.45 a pound, but are on sale now for $0.35 a pound. If I need longer pieces I look in the remnants stack for what I need. A piece cut from a remnant is cheaper than from a full 20 ft. stick.

    I usually check the s**** rack and the remnant stack once a week. I keep a list of the steel I need for different projects and if they have an item on the list, I get it. A couple of weeks ago they had a 12" x 18" x 1/2" thick piece of plate which is just the right size for the disk sander I'm making from av8's old American Rodder article. $0.35 a pound is cheap. I usually have several project on the list for which to buy.

    i got hold of 2 steel entrance doors from a building rehab 18ga 4 sheets 31x74 i cut them open about a 1/2 inch away from the edge there is bracing and styra foam inside good saw or cut off wheel works 1st one was a test they do have other gauge metal i think 16 and 14 there is a tag on the door frame
